MASCO Delivers Strong Q1 Performance: Operating Margins Expand and Guidance Remains Steady

Sales Growth and Margin Expansion Signal Momentum

Masco Corporation (NYSE: MAS) started 2026 on a solid note, reporting 6% higher net sales at $1,918 million for the first quarter. The company’s operating profit margin increased to 16.5%, with the adjusted operating margin climbing even further to 16.9%. These figures demonstrate not just top-line momentum, but also effective cost management and incremental profitability, even amid dynamic macroeconomic conditions.

Adjusted Earnings Jump and Capital Returns Highlight Financial Discipline

Adjusted earnings per share reached $1.04, growing 20% from a year ago. Operating profit on an adjusted basis rose 13% to $324 million. Meanwhile, capital discipline was evident as Masco repurchased 3.1 million shares for $202 million and returned a total of $267 million to shareholders through dividends and buybacks in the quarter. The company’s liquidity stood strong with $1,261 million in total available cash and credit at quarter’s end.

Segment Highlights: Plumbing and Decorative Products Chart Diverging Paths

The Plumbing Products segment led the way, with net sales up 9% and adjusted operating profit increasing to $250 million. Meanwhile, Decorative Architectural Products maintained steady sales but achieved meaningful improvement in adjusted operating margin to 19.0%, up from 15.8% last year. This divergence shows that while topline growth is not uniform, margin management is making a positive impact in core business lines.

Segment Q1 2026 Net Sales ($M) Q1 2025 Net Sales ($M) Adjusted Operating Margin (%)
Plumbing Products 1,364 1,246 18.3
Decorative Architectural Products 554 556 19.0
Total 1,918 1,801 16.9

Balance Sheet Bolstered Despite Heavy Share Repurchases

Even with significant outflows for buybacks, Masco’s total assets were largely unchanged at just over $5.2 billion, while its liquidity ratio remained healthy. Operating cash flows improved to $289 million, and working capital as a percentage of last-twelve-months’ sales ticked up to 19.5%, indicating both operational efficiency and a conservative approach to balance sheet management.

Key Financial Metric Q1 2026 Q1 2025
Operating Cash Flow ($M) 289 262
Liquidity ($M) 1,261 1,246
Working Capital ($M) 1,494 1,437
Working Capital as % of Sales 19.5% 18.7%

Guidance Maintained: Confident Amidst Uncertainties

Masco reaffirmed its adjusted earnings per share guidance for 2026, targeting $4.10–$4.30. Management cited ongoing market uncertainties but emphasized the durability of its business model and strong brand portfolio. There’s a cautious optimism that core strengths and disciplined capital allocation will continue to deliver value, even as economic and geopolitical risks persist.
